Concentric diamonds center this intriguing sculpture, their color enhanced by applications of white clay. Ghanaian artisan Salihu Ibrahim carves the sculpture from sese wood, replicating the diminutive ottoman thrones used as pillows by the Senufu tribe.

Story Behind the Art:
'Upon the death of my father, I was sent to live with one of my father's closest friends, a renowned traditional carver to the then Akwamu chief and the people of Akwamu,' Salihu Ibrahim says. 'I worked with him for about 15 years, during which time I learned the styles and techniques of the Ashanti and Akwamu people. My work began to flourish and achieve recognition, and today, I have apprentice carvers working with me to learn the art of carving.'
